The school library is available to all students during regular school hours. Classes are scheduled for regular library times throughout the week.  

Three-year-olds, Pre-K, and Kindergarteners participate in a story time each week when they visit the library. The story time includes finger plays, flannel board stories, songs, student participation stories, and a craft/coloring sheet, along with books. 

First and Second Graders participate in an age-appropriate story time each week and then check-out books.

Third through Fifth graders are learning library skills and also check-out books each week. They will learn the parts of a book,  the Dewey Decimal System, how to look up and find books in the library using the online catalog, how to use a variety of reference materials, and about different genres of literature.

The 6th-8th graders also have scheduled times to come and check out books as they need them during their English class.

All library books are due one week from the day they are checked-out from the library. If the student is not finished reading the book, they need to renew it in the library on the day it is due. Overdue fines are $.05 per day.  The students are responsible for the books they check-out, if the book is lost they must pay to replace it.
